Lab37 Robotics, is a technology company focused on the development and deployment of robots designed specifically for direct-to-customer food production. Our mission is to revolutionize the food industry by creating innovative robotic solutions that enhance efficiency, quality, and customer satisfaction. We are passionate about pushing the boundaries of technology to deliver cutting-edge products that meet the evolving needs of our clients.
About the Role
~1 min readOwn product leadership for Lab37's operations tools portfolio. You will build and manage a team of Product Managers covering products including robot fleet management, customer support, and learning management systems. You will set direction, lead product operations, and ensure teams develop impactful products with measurable results.
Responsibilities
~1 min read- →Build and manage the team: Manage and develop Product Managers, giving each clear ownership. Hire and evolve the team as the portfolio grows.
- →Set portfolio direction: Own the roadmap and investment choices across operations tools. Make priorities and tradeoffs clear to leadership and the team. Resolve ambiguity and unblock critical decisions.
- →Lead product operations: Establish lightweight planning and review rhythms across the portfolio. Manage tradeoffs and track outcomes. Hold teams accountable for timely delivery and adoption, with measurable results.
- →Own cross-product intelligence: Build the shared portfolio view that connects fleet health and service history to support patterns and workforce readiness. Turn cross-product signals into priorities and measurable action.
- →Deliver quality products on time: Manage product quality and drive on time delivery across your portfolio of products. Make tradeoffs to optimize business value given limited resources.
- →Align change management across products: Ensure changes to robots, software, and operating processes reach the field as one coordinated experience. Align fleet rollout and monitoring with support diagnostics and workforce learning.
- →Own continuous improvement: Establish a comprehensive continuous improvement cycle, tracking issues from initial detection and diagnosis through to successful resolution. Confirm that changes prevent recurrence and improve operating results.
